How a Bungee Improves Mouse Precision and Consistency

The physics are simple: any cable drag introduces variable resistance that changes based on your mouse position. This inconsistent feedback loop forces your hand to compensate unconsciously, creating micro-hesitations that affect flick shots, tracking, and overall precision. A properly engineered bungee lifts the cable at an optimal angle, creating a consistent arc that moves with your mouse movements rather than against them. For streamers who play competitive titles while broadcasting, this consistency translates to better performance that your audience can actually see.

Weighted Base vs. Clamp-On Designs

Weighted bases provide stability and portability, typically using steel plates or sand-filled chambers that keep the unit planted during aggressive mouse movements. Clamp-on designs attach directly to your desk edge, offering rock-solid stability without occupying surface area but limiting repositioning flexibility. Your choice depends on whether you frequently reconfigure your setup or need a permanent streaming station solution.

Understanding Different Bungee Mechanisms

Spring-Loaded Arm Systems

These classic designs use a coiled spring to provide upward tension while allowing horizontal movement. The spring rate determines how much force lifts your cable—too stiff and you’ll feel resistance; too soft and the arm collapses. Advanced models use progressive springs that adapt to cable weight and provide consistent lift across the entire mousepad surface. Look for systems with noise dampening, as spring squeak can be picked up by sensitive streaming microphones.

Flexible Gooseneck Designs

Gooseneck arms offer infinite adjustability, letting you position the cable exit point exactly where you need it. While they lack the automatic spring return of coil systems, their flexibility makes them ideal for streamers who use multiple mice or frequently change their setup. The trade-off is that goosenecks can develop memory and sag over time, requiring occasional repositioning to maintain optimal cable arc.

Retractable Cable Management

Some cutting-edge 2026 bungees incorporate retractable spools that automatically take up slack as you move your mouse back toward the base. This system eliminates any possibility of cable drag but adds mechanical complexity. The retraction force must be precisely calibrated—too strong and it pulls your mouse backward; too weak and it doesn’t retract fully. These work best with lightweight, flexible cables specifically designed for this application.

Magnetic Attachment Points

Magnetic cable holders represent the minimalist end of the spectrum, using strong neodymium magnets to create breakaway connections that prevent cable yanking if you accidentally pull too far. While not true bungees, they solve the same problem through different physics. Some hybrid designs combine magnetic clips with a traditional arm, giving you the security of a fixed point with the safety of a breakaway connection.

Cable Routing Best Practices

Route your mouse cable under your monitor arm or along desk edges to reach the bungee without creating new snag points. Leave enough slack between the bungee grip and mouse to allow full pad coverage. The cable should enter the grip naturally, without sharp bends that could damage the internal wires over time. Some streamers use small adhesive cable clips to create a clean channel from their PC to the bungee base.

Positioning Relative to Your Mouse and Monitor

The bungee arm should elevate the cable 2-4 inches above the mousepad surface, creating a gentle parabolic arc. Too low and you’ll still experience drag; too high and the cable becomes a visual distraction. The arm’s pivot point should align with your most common mouse position—typically the center of your pad—to minimize lateral cable movement during flick shots.

Noise Reduction Features

Spring squeak, cable rubbing, and base vibration can all bleed into your microphone signal. Quality bungees use nylon bushings in pivot points, silicone dampeners on springs, and weighted isolation in the base. Some designs incorporate acoustic foam inside hollow arm tubes to prevent resonance. Test for noise by recording silence while moving your mouse aggressively—any audible artifacts will be amplified by compression.

Troubleshooting Common Issues

Dealing with Cable Slippage

If your cable pulls through the grip during aggressive movements, first check that you’re using the correct insert size. Tighten adjustment screws incrementally—over-tightening damages cables. For paracord-modded mice, wrap a small piece of electrical tape around the cable where it enters the grip to increase diameter and friction. Some streamers use zip-tie anchors as a backup retention method.

When Your Bungee Moves During Use

Base sliding indicates insufficient weight or poor pad grip. Add weight using stick-on steel plates or switch to a clamp-mount model. For weighted bases, clean the silicone pads with isopropyl alcohol to restore tackiness. On glass desks, use clear adhesive gel pads under the base corners. If the arm itself is shifting, tighten the pivot mechanism—many have hidden set screws that loosen over time.

Compatibility Issues with Thick Braided Cables

Oversized cables won’t fit standard grips. Look for bungees advertising “large diameter compatibility” or modify your approach: remove the braiding near the grip point (carefully, to avoid damage) or use a short cable extension with a thinner profile. Some 2026 models include adjustable jaw grips that open wider while maintaining even pressure distribution.

Maintenance and Cleaning Tips

Dust and oil buildup affect grip performance and aesthetics. Clean your bungee monthly with microfiber cloths and mild soap solution. Avoid harsh chemicals that degrade rubber components. Lubricate spring mechanisms with dry PTFE spray—never use oil-based lubricants that attract dust. For RGB models, compressed air keeps LED channels clear of debris that causes uneven lighting.

How do I prevent the bungee arm from squeaking during streams?

Apply dry PTFE lubricant to pivot points and spring coils monthly. Avoid oil-based lubricants that attract dust. If squeaking persists, disassemble the arm (if possible) and check for metal-on-metal contact points that may need nylon washers. Some premium models use sealed bearings that eliminate this issue entirely.
